The Companies Act 2006 (the “2006 Act”) codifies directors’ general duties in Part 10 of Chapter 2.
The duties are:
- to act within powers;
- to promote the success of the company;
- to exercise independent judgment;
- to exercise reasonable care, skill and diligence;
- to avoid conflicts of interest;
- not to accept benefits from third parties; and
- to declare interest in a proposed transaction or arrangement.
The first four of these duties took effect on 1 October 2007 and the last three will take effect on 1 October 2008.
